Reply to post: Why, what?

Dumb bug of the week: Apple's macOS reveals your encrypted drive's password in the hint box

hellwig Silver badge

Why, what?

Question, why is the password stored at all, anywhere? Shouldn't it be immediately hashed?

This was addressed by clearing hint storage if the hint was the password, and by improving the logic for storing hints.

Improving "logic" for storing hints. I suppose it used to be

if (True) {

Store_Hint(Password.To_Plain_Text());

}

and now its

if (False) {

Store_Hint(Password.To_Plain_Text());

}

else {

Store_Hint(Hint.To_Plain_Text());

}

POST COMMENT House rules

Not a member of The Register? Create a new account here.

  • Enter your comment

  • Add an icon

Anonymous cowards cannot choose their icon

Biting the hand that feeds IT © 1998–2019